☐ Roof-terrace door check (first-day task). The terrace door on level 5 at Brindlemoor House jams when it's humid — give it a firm shoulder, don't force the handle or it pops off (ask Teo, he's done it twice). Prop it only with the official wedge, never a chair, or the alarm trips. Check it closes fully at end of shift. The keypad entry to the terrace is the code below.

door code, yagap-bahof: bdg-O-05

== Marketing Budget Adjustment — FY Planning (Managers Only) ==

This page documents the reduction to the central marketing budget at Quendale Foods, approved by the steering group. The cut applies primarily to trade-show spend and the Bramblewick campaign; digital channels are largely protected. Department heads should resubmit revised spend plans within two weeks. Please treat figures as provisional until Finance confirms. The broader commercial rationale appears in the note below.

board note of tadup-tajog: Headcount on the Oliiel team goes from 31 to 88 by the end of February. Gross margin on Oliiel came in at 62 percent against a plan of 29 percent.

Colleagues, attached is the proposed headcount plan for next year at Brindlemoor Analytics. We project 34 net additions: 18 in engineering for the Oakline platform, 9 in customer success, 7 in operations. Backfill assumptions are conservative at 11% attrition. The Tarnwick office absorbs most growth; the Vessing site remains flat pending the capacity review. Please review the phasing schedule carefully before Thursday's session. The related confidential note on expansion plans appears directly below.

internal memo for yahag-hahig: Belwynix Group plans to lower the Silir list price by 62 percent in May.